Transaction 9a8115514cbc673a253c53d688156793f90e6f6f8bd908d04dc1f2407d799064
1 Input
1 Output
-
9a8115514cbc673a253c53d688156793f90e6f6f8bd908d04dc1f2407d799064:0
- value
- 15327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7b01706734259cfe05cb1a174e74bb2b31bae17 OP_EQUAL
- address
- 3QGfmsPPrLtgkc5anGzaHLpDuRb5idvZeC